Carl Reinecke (1824 - 1910) was a prominent German composer, pianist, conductor, and music educator. He lived for many years in Copenhagen (Denmark) and Leipzig (Germany). From 1860 to 1895, he served as Kapellmeister at the Gewandhaus and also directed the conservatory. There, he trained musicians such as Edvard Grieg and Isaac Albéniz. His compositions are written in the style of the Viennese Classical period and early Romanticism.
The Allegretto is the first movement from the Fantasiestücke for violin or clarinet and piano, Op. 22. It is a graceful piece - as the performance title suggests - with a romantic, lyrical character. The catchy, song-like melody engages in a dialogue with the piano. The composition has a cheerful, joyful, and at the same time relaxed character.
